Columbia is a private liberal arts womens college with coeducational evening and graduate programs. The college offers a unique emphasis on leadership development, offering 35 undergraduate majors in a wide array of challenging fields, an honors program and opportunities for individualized study.
Each of Columbia College's programs emphasizes service, social justice, and leadership. Our modestly-sized student body enables close, meaningful connections and relationships between students and professors.
As a student at Columbia College, you will have the opportunity to participate in a wide variety of activities, events, and organizations. You can choose from political action groups, student government, musical groups, religious groups, honor societies, social service clubs, dances groups and a theatre club. In addition, qualified students can serve as Ambassadors or Presidential Aides.
